Jeongeup-si Hosts 'Byeollara Travel Festival' After 3 Years
[Jeongeup=Asia Economy Honam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Kim Jae-gil] Jeongeup City, Jeonbuk Province, announced on the 26th that it will hold the "22nd Star Country Travel Festival" at the National Jeonbuk Meteorological Science Museum from 2 PM to 10 PM on the 29th.
Held for the first time in three years due to COVID-19, this event is hosted by the Jeongeup Astronomy Research Association, the National Jeonbuk Meteorological Science Museum, and Hyesung (a club at Jeongju High School), and supported by Jeongeup City, Jeonbuk Jeongeup Office of Education, Jeonju Meteorological Office, Jeongju High School, and Jeonbuk Science University (Department of Smart Information).
This festival offers a variety of astronomical science experiences where visitors can feel and experience the mysteries of the universe through observing the autumn night sky and constellations sparkling like jewels.
A special astronomy lecture will be given by Dr. Lee Tae-hyung, Korea's top amateur astronomy authority and the first Korean to discover asteroid 23880.
Additionally, a celestial observation photography contest designed to increase youth understanding and interest in astronomy will be held, with generous prizes and gifts including telescopes, expected to further enhance the festival atmosphere.
Lee Jeong-yeol, president of the Jeongeup Astronomy Research Association, said, "Due to worsening air pollution these days, it is becoming increasingly difficult to see stars in the city," and added, "We hope people visit the Jeonbuk Meteorological Science Museum to have the opportunity to directly observe various celestial bodies."
